How To Choose The Best Cooling Mattress Covers
A cooling mattress cover does two jobs at once: it protects the mattress and it manages your body heat. Before you buy, you need to decide which of those jobs matters more to you, because the best cover for a hot sleeper is not always the best one for a family with young kids.
Fabric and the cooling effect
The top layer is what touches your skin, and it decides how cool the bed feels. Bamboo viscose is soft and breathable, but its cooling power is gentle. A nylon-spandex knit gives an instant cool-to-the-touch feeling. The strongest option is a phase-change material (PCM), a fabric layer that absorbs heat when you are warm and releases it as you cool down. If you sleep hot, look for nylon or a named cooling technology like Arc-Chill.
Waterproofing versus breathability
A waterproof layer, usually a TPU membrane on the underside, stops sweat and spills from soaking into the mattress. The catch is that some waterproof barriers trap heat. The best designs use a breathable membrane that blocks liquid but still lets air move. If you only want cooling and do not need spill protection, a non-waterproof pad like the EASELAND is a fair trade for maximum airflow.
Deep pockets and fit
Modern mattresses are thick. A cover with a shallow pocket will pop off at the corners by morning. Check the pocket depth in inches — 18 inches fits most standard beds, while 21 inches handles extra-thick pillow-top and foam mattresses. A full elastic skirt and corner straps keep the cover smooth and silent all night.

1. PlushDeluxe Bamboo Waterproof Mattress Protector
Our pick — over 4.5★ from 42,500+ verified ratings; the strongest balance of quality and price.
Nearly 43,000 owners make this the crowd favorite, and the reason is a familiar one: it protects the bed without feeling like a protective layer.
The top is 60% bamboo viscose, a plant-derived fabric that wicks moisture and lets heat escape instead of trapping it against you. It fits a King at 76×80 inches and stretches over mattresses up to 18 inches deep, so the corners stay tucked on thick pillow-top beds. It is completely silent — no crinkling when you turn over.
What wins people over is the combination of quality and fit. The waterproof layer handles spills, sweat, and the occasional pet accident, and owners find it washes well in cold water on a delicate cycle with a low-heat tumble dry. The honest trade-off is that a few sleepers find the cooling effect mild, and one buyer notes it lacks the plush cushion of a padded topper — it is a protector, not a comfort layer.
For the money, this is the safest bet for most households. It balances protection, silence, and a genuinely soft sleep surface, and the 4.6-star average across tens of thousands of owners is hard to argue with.

2. Elegear Cooling Mattress Pad with Arc-Chill 3.0
This is the one for genuine hot sleepers, using a phase-change print layer that actively absorbs your body heat instead of just feeling cool to the touch.
Unlike the bamboo covers above, which breathe but do not actively cool, the Elegear pairs a 90% cooling nylon top with a PCM layer that pulls heat away when you are warm and releases it as you cool down. Owners describe a noticeably cooler, more rested night with fewer wake-ups — One buyer called the effect “life-changing” for hot flashes.. The fabric is cool to the touch the moment you lie down, thanks to the Arc-Chill 3.0 knit.
The 3D mesh TriSupport layer keeps air moving and adds a touch of cushioning, and the fully elastic edges hold tight on mattresses up to 18 inches deep. It is OEKO-TEX Standard 100 certified, so it is gentle on sensitive skin. The real caveat is honesty about the effect: a few owners found the cooling faded after a few hours, and the brand advises sleeping directly on it without an extra sheet for best results. It is not waterproof, so this is a cooling pad, not a spill guard.

Understanding the Specs
Cooling Technology: PCM vs. Bamboo vs. Nylon
The cooling effect comes from the top fabric layer. A phase-change material (PCM) actively absorbs heat from your body and releases it as you cool down — this is the strongest cooling tech, found on the Elegear. A nylon-spandex knit gives an instant cool-to-the-touch feeling that fades as the bed warms, like the EASELAND. Bamboo viscose is the softest and most breathable, but its cooling is gentle, like the PlushDeluxe. Match the tech to how hot you actually sleep.
Pocket Depth and the Elastic Skirt
The pocket depth tells you how thick a mattress the cover will grip. A standard mattress is around 12 inches, so an 18-inch pocket gives good coverage, while a 21-inch pocket handles extra-thick pillow-top and deep foam beds. A fully elastic skirt, rather than just corner straps, is what keeps the cover from bunching or popping off when you turn over. Measure your mattress depth before buying so you do not end up with a cover that slips by morning.
